The Arab coalition Supporting Legitimacy in Yemen asked civilians on Monday to immediately evacuate Sanaa international airport, in the Yemeni capital controlled by the terrorist Houthi militias.
The coalition called on the workers of international and humanitarian organisations in the airport to immediately evacuate as it has taken "legal measures to deal with the threat operationally.”
The coalition launched precise and specific air strikes on legitimate military targets at Sanaa airport
